The Manchester Phoenix Under-16A squad Awards Night was held last Saturday for a party of thirty-five players and family members. Club sponsors Frankie and Benny's provided the venue after an 'In-House' scrimmage at the rink.
The Phoenix U-16A squad finished a creditable fifth in the club's first season in the U-16 A league, and Elite club GM Andy Costigan was on hand as each of the players picked up their memento of the season and four collected special achievement awards and he commented, "The Junior club has come an awful long way in two years and the committee headed by Paul Brown have done a marvellous job and their efforts duly recognised. Our club is not solely about the Elite League squad and it's great to see so many players enjoying their sport and yearning to progress."
Paul Brown added, "Next season could be even better in terms of even more development... as we're very hopeful of adding two further tiers of youngsters in the shape of both Under-10s' and Under 12s' and that will truly give us the ladder right up to the Elite League level for all youngsters to aim at."
Pictured from left to right are:
Ryan Pike - Coach's Player of the Year
Tom Hammond - Top Points Scorer
Marc Etherington - Most Improved Player of the Year
Conner Dakin - Players' Player of the Year
